CPI
Stands for Consumer Price Index, which measures the average change over time in the prices paid by urban consumers for a market basket of consumer goods and services.
GDP Deflator
A benchmark for evaluating the price levels of all new, home-produced, end-use goods and services within an economic system.
Price Index
A measure that examines the weighted average of prices of a basket of consumer goods and services over time.
